﻿// Archivo JScript
function tieneDatos(Valor) { 
	for (var i=0; i< Valor.length; i++) { 
	if ((' \t\n\r').indexOf(Valor.charAt(i))==-1) return true; 
	} 
	return false; 
}
function esfecha(objeto,Valor) { 
	
	if (Valor.length <= 10){
		if (!tieneDatos(Valor)) 
			return true; 
		var DatosFecha = Valor.split('/'); 
		var Fecha = new Date(); 
		Fecha.setFullYear(DatosFecha[2],DatosFecha[1]-1,DatosFecha[0]); 
		mes = parseFloat(DatosFecha[1]) - 1;
		if (!(Fecha.getMonth() == mes)){
			alert('La fecha introducida no es correcta') ;
			objeto.value = '';
			objeto.focus();
		}
	}
	else{
		alert('La fecha introducida no es correcta') ;
		objeto.value = '';
		objeto.focus();			
	}
}
